St. Jude Children's Research Hospital, founded by the late entertainer Danny Thomas, is the nation’s leading children’s cancer research and treatment hospital, and the only one that covers all of the costs for medicine, treatment, food, travel and lodging. Children come to St. Jude from across the country, and 85 cents of every dollar received supports research and treatment. Today Danny’s legacy continues to thrive through the commitment of his children Marlo, Terre and Tony Thomas, who work tirelessly to honor their father's promise that no child is ever turned away because of a family’s inability to pay.

Target House is an innovative approach to long-term housing for families whose children are receiving lifesaving treatment at St. Jude Children's Research Hospital in Memphis, Tennessee. This unique facility, funded by Target and its vendor and celebrity partner contributions, features 96 apartment suites that are free of charge to families of children whose treatments require that they be in Memphis for at least 90 days.

Sykes first began working in stand up in 1987, and since then has had a
successful career as a comic, a writer and an actor. In addition to her TV
work, including "The New Adventures of Old Christine," she has appeared in
more than a dozen movies, including "Evan Almighty," "Monster-in-Law" and
"My Super Ex-Girlfriend," and has been heard in such animated features as
"Barnyard" and "Over the Hedge."

She has been nominated as a performer and writer for three Emmys and
won as a writer in 1999. In 2001, she won the American Comedy Award for
Outstanding Female Stand-up Comic.

Introducing this year's honorees:

Cypress Hill: With a driving rhyme style and brutally infectious production, this L.A. based collective brought a welcomed Latino perspective to hip hop storytelling, creating records like "Insane in the Brain" that crossed all barriers and gave Cypress Hill fans in the rock, as well as, rap world.

De La Soul: This Long Island trio brought a playful, smart, and off-center style to hip hop, while pushing their suburban and bohemian sensibility to the fore. Their innovative sound has influenced not only other MCs, but helped inspire the entire underground movement in the culture.

Naughty By Nature: Led by the strident style of lead MC Treach, Naughty By Nature brought New Jersey hip hop into the mainstream by creating hit singles than became anthems for a generation. "OPP" and "Hip Hop Hooray" are two of the most popular records in rap history.

Slick Rick: With vivid storytelling and unique rhyme style Slick Rick has always been one of the most unique and influential figures in the culture's history. When you combine Rick's MC gifts with his gold chains, eye patch and regal clothing the result is a figure who embodies the fun, the danger and the flavor that is hip hop.

Too $hort: Too $hort started his career in the '80s selling 12-inch singles full of freaky tales on his own indie label in Oakland and has remained true to his raw style, in the process becoming a legend in the game while staying true to his hard core values.

Rockers Linkin Park are set to play two charity concerts in China in October.

The shows will take place on October 12 at the 80,000-seat Shanghai Stadium and on October 19 at the 72,000-seat Beijing Workers’ Stadium, and will feature top Taiwanese rock group Mayday. Each band will perform for about 90 minutes to – according to organizers – make it the “first ever East meets West rock concert” in China.

Proceeds from the concerts will be donated to Linkin Park’s Music for Relief – a charity they established in 2005 to provide aid to victims of natural disasters around the world – to help with reconstruction of China’s quake-devastated Sichuan Province. Lead vocalist Chester Bennington said the band hopes the concerts will call more attention to the ongoing efforts in the quake-affected areas and that they are proud to be helping the people in need.
